> Since the beginning of 2017, we have setup 4 NiFi 1.1.2 cluster, one of them
> is our BTS environment, one is our Prod environment, totally we have met the
> problem more than 20 times, so we organize a team for researching after same
> issue occurred on Prod.
> After debugging and analysis, we found the cause is that every time cluster
> node connect to cluster, cluster will get cluster data flow then compare with
> local data flow, if it's different, cluster node can't connect to cluster. So
> we start to research why the data flow is different next, and we found a case
> which will cause this problem.
> We open two browser tab, we called them A and B; tab A connect to node-1, at
> first, we disconnect node-1 in tab B, next, we will add a processor on tab
> A, finally we refresh tab A we will find node-1 can't connect to cluster due
> to difference between local data flow and cluster data flow.
